Number of atomic species of degree n which are not nontrivial substitutions. (Formerly M1029)
|
|
+0 3
|
|
| 0, 1, 1, 2, 4, 6, 19, 20, 111, 116, 567, 641, 4718

REFERENCES
|
N. J. A. Sloane and Simon Plouffe, The Encyclopedia of Integer Sequences, Academic Press, 1995 (includes this sequence).
J. Labelle and Y. N. Yeh, The relation between Burnside rings and combinatorial species, J. Combin. Theory, A 50 (1989), 269-284.
|
|
FORMULA
|
Define b(n), c(n): b(1)=c(0)=0. b(k)=a(k), k>1. c(k)=A000638(k), k>0. A005226(n) is Dirichlet convolution of b and c. - Christian G. Bower (bowerc(AT)usa.net), Feb 23 2006
